Create MMS Template


URL:

https://api2.protexting.com/v1/mms-template/create?access_token=your_access_token


Method:

POST

Request parameters:

* required parameters

Parameter Description
* ResourceLink  String, Url to media
Name  String

Response parameters:

Parameter Description
Id Integer, MMS Template Id
Name String, MMS Template Name
Url String
DateCreated String
Status_Id Integer,  see here »
Status_Description String, see here »

Example Request:

curl -i -H "Accept:application/json" -H "Content-Type:application/json" -XPOST "https://api2.protexting.com/v1/mms-template/create?access_token=your_access_token" -d '{"ResourceLink":"https://www.protexting.com/images/newdesign/features/Text-in-JOIN.png","Name":"My Image"}'

 

Example Response Headers:

Status Code: 201 Created
Cache-Control: no-store, no-cache, must-revalidate, post-check=0, pre-check=0
Connection: Keep-Alive
Content-Length: 243
Content-Type: application/json; charset=UTF-8
Keep-Alive: timeout=5, max=100
Pragma: no-cache
X-Powered-By: PHP/5.6.2
X-Rate-Limit-Limit: 60
X-Rate-Limit-Remaining: 59
X-Rate-Limit-Reset

Example Response Body:

{ 
"Id": 10586,
"Name": "My Image",
"Url": "https://mms.protexting.com/uploads/media/46e446d800290d2922b1.jpg",
"DateCreated": "2015-01-20 10:21:29",
"Status_Id": 0,
"Status_Description": "Pending for processing"
}
<response>
<Id>10586</Id>
<Name>My Image</Name>
<Url>https://mms.protexting.com/uploads/media/46e446d800290d2922b1.jpg</Url>
<DateCreated>2015-01-20 10:21:29</DateCreated>
<Status_Id>0</Status_Id>
<Status_Description>Pending for processing</Status_Description>
</response>

HTTP Status Codes:

The standard HTTP Status Codes are used. More information is available here: http://www.iana.org/assignments/http-status-codes/http-status-codes.xhtml

Error Codes:

Error Codes and Examples here »

Statuses

Status_Id Status_Description Final Status
0 Pending for processing No
1 Processing No
2 Processed pending approval No
3 Approved Yes
4 Rejected Yes
5 Processed Failed Yes